Transaction dd769fcdd522d70149fffaaffe8579e4a1d864256ec8828dfcbbab7596ecf1ed
1 Input
2 Outputs
- dd769fcdd522d70149fffaaffe8579e4a1d864256ec8828dfcbbab7596ecf1ed:0
- dd769fcdd522d70149fffaaffe8579e4a1d864256ec8828dfcbbab7596ecf1ed:1
value 2439250
address 1GuKWrN88x2qLs41TMxdQPrNduA2QUubaF
value 9500000
address 3C77TvpcqUdgaXpDWSi9fDNY9D31NxopLA